async installMessageAntiRevokeTrigger(sessionId: string): Promise<{ success: boolean; alreadyInstalled?: boolean; error?: string }> {
if (!this.ensureReady()) return { success: false, error: 'WCDB 未连接' }
if (!this.wcdbInstallMessageAntiRevokeTrigger) return { success: false, error: '当前 DLL 版本不支持此功能' }
const normalizedSessionId = String(sessionId || '').trim()
if (!normalizedSessionId) return { success: false, error: 'sessionId 不能为空' }
try {
const outPtr = [null]
const status = this.wcdbInstallMessageAntiRevokeTrigger(this.handle, normalizedSessionId, outPtr)
let msg = ''
if (outPtr[0]) {
try { msg = this.koffi.decode(outPtr[0], 'char', -1) } catch { }
try { this.wcdbFreeString(outPtr[0]) } catch { }
}
if (status === 1) {
return { success: true, alreadyInstalled: true }
}
if (status !== 0) {
return { success: false, error: msg || `DLL error ${status}` }
}
return { success: true, alreadyInstalled: false }
} catch (e) {
return { success: false, error: String(e) }
}
}
async uninstallMessageAntiRevokeTrigger(sessionId: string): Promise<{ success: boolean; error?: string }> {
if (!this.ensureReady()) return { success: false, error: 'WCDB 未连接' }
if (!this.wcdbUninstallMessageAntiRevokeTrigger) return { success: false, error: '当前 DLL 版本不支持此功能' }
const normalizedSessionId = String(sessionId || '').trim()
if (!normalizedSessionId) return { success: false, error: 'sessionId 不能为空' }
try {
const outPtr = [null]
const status = this.wcdbUninstallMessageAntiRevokeTrigger(this.handle, normalizedSessionId, outPtr)
let msg = ''
if (outPtr[0]) {
try { msg = this.koffi.decode(outPtr[0], 'char', -1) } catch { }
try { this.wcdbFreeString(outPtr[0]) } catch { }
}
if (status !== 0) {
return { success: false, error: msg || `DLL error ${status}` }
}
return { success: true }
} catch (e) {
return { success: false, error: String(e) }
}
}
async checkMessageAntiRevokeTrigger(sessionId: string): Promise<{ success: boolean; installed?: boolean; error?: string }> {
if (!this.ensureReady()) return { success: false, error: 'WCDB 未连接' }
if (!this.wcdbCheckMessageAntiRevokeTrigger) return { success: false, error: '当前 DLL 版本不支持此功能' }
const normalizedSessionId = String(sessionId || '').trim()
if (!normalizedSessionId) return { success: false, error: 'sessionId 不能为空' }
try {
const outInstalled = [0]
const status = this.wcdbCheckMessageAntiRevokeTrigger(this.handle, normalizedSessionId, outInstalled)
if (status !== 0) {
return { success: false, error: `DLL error ${status}` }
}
return { success: true, installed: outInstalled[0] === 1 }
} catch (e) {
return { success: false, error: String(e) }
}
}
